Output bafaee8757517a84c24c15b5176b23aa5feaf9b404e1955838432b767883f5ed:1

value
165380550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6b0d5d33a90a7599cd7301d3afb1a2b5bddd447 OP_EQUAL
address
3GtPw7i5ZaNcv6nsiYzDrMQTGoTGZ9Mr7w
transaction
bafaee8757517a84c24c15b5176b23aa5feaf9b404e1955838432b767883f5ed
confirmations
308979
spent
true